Geography Unit 15 (Y6) The Mountain Environment KS2. These resources also link to work in KS3 on how mountains are formed and mountain peoples.
This pack contains 13 books in two differentiated levels. A pack of activities such as dictionaries, and vocabulary flashcards is included to support this unit.
The focus is on what a mountain environment is like and where they can be found in the UK and across the world. There is a section on tourism and an activity based around planning a holiday in a mountain area.
